    We visited Prescott briefly, and I wanted to grab a bite to eat. We saw Brown Bag Brewery and decided to drop in. Rustic, burger joint decor. The service was ok. She forgot my ice water (not really a big deal, as i was eating my meal). She realized later when I had finished and asked for a box that I had no ice water on my table. She apologized and offered to get me a takeout cup. That was nice. Touted as the "The Best Burger(s) in Prescott" I went with the... BBQ Burger: beer battered onion rings, cheddar, pickles, applewood smoked bacon, bbq sauce, house beer mustard (3.5/5). My order came out so fast. I was surprised. The meat was cooked perfectly, and all the ingredients were tasty in what you'd expect a burger with bbq sauce would be like. The disappointing part of it was the bun. It was toasted too long, so it was a bit dry and hard. My other complaint was the fries. They seemed to have either been cooked beforehand and sitting around, and then double fried to where they are hot and crisp again but dried out and hard to eat. I did mention the fries to my server, and she did acknowledge that, "maybe the fryer's setting was too high and the kitchen was cooking them too long at that high temp, which dried out the fries". Yep, that's another possibility. I buy that. I appreciate her honesty. Note: Yelp Check-in, 10% off the bill. Overall 3.5 stars. If they can work out the kinks, I am sure they will stand on their billing of "The Best Burger(s) in Prescott." They definitely are off to a good start!
